What is Double Glazing?
Double glazing describes a window system that consists of 2 layers of glass sealed together, with an insulating gap in between. This design considerably decreases heat transfer, thus enhancing a property's energy efficiency.

The double glazing procedure includes a number of actions. Below is an in-depth explanation of these steps:
1. Selecting the Right Glazing Type
Before setup, property owners should decide between different double glazing alternatives, consisting of:
Argon Gas-Filled: A common choice, where argon gas offers enhanced insulation.Low-E (Low Emissivity) Glass: This glass has an unique finishing that reflects heat back into the room, more enhancing energy performance.Acoustic Glass: Designed to decrease noise, suitable for homes in loud environments.2. 4. Manufacturing the Double Glazing Units
After confirmation, the selected specs are sent to the factory where the double-glazed systems are manufactured. This consists of cutting the glass panes, including the spacer bars, and sealing the systems.

Appropriate maintenance of double-glazed windows can considerably lengthen their life-span. Here are some ideas:
Regular Cleaning: Use non-abrasive cleaners for the glass and frames.Inspect Seals: Conduct regular evaluations for any signs of wear and tear on seals.Clear Drainage Holes: Ensure drain holes are devoid of particles to avoid moisture accumulation.Examine for Condensation: Frequent condensation may indicate seal failure, necessitating timely attention.Prospective Drawbacks
